OMB Watch Provides Access to DHS Comments

OMB Watch donated three hours so that public comments submitted to the Department of Homeland Security (DHS) regarding its proposed Critical Infrastructure Information (CII) rule are available for review electronically. DHS officials informed OMB Watch last week of their intention to post the CII docket on the agency’s website. The docket contains the 64 substantive comments submitted on the proposed rule. DHS expected the comments would be available Tuesday September 2, but as of close of business Wednesday there is still no sign of the docket on the DHS website. DHS shared with OMB Watch copies of all the CII comments while preparing to post the docket. In the interest of public access, OMB Watch will provide online access to the public comments while DHS works to make its official docket available. The planned online docket is an important step in DHS’s approach to public access. Originally, reports indicated that DHS planned to post the comments only when the final rule was published.
